International Labour Confederation (ILC) at a Glance
Established in 2022 and officially launched following its inaugural General Assembly in 2024, the International Labour Confederation (ILC) marked a significant milestone with the “At a Glance” meeting, held as part of the International Congress on Labour, Digitalization, and Social Justice. The event took place in Türkiye, bringing together 200 trade union leaders representing 50 confederations, 3 regional labour organizations, and 41 countries.
The glance meeting of the ILC served as a platform for forging new partnerships and strengthening global solidarity. Declarations of intent for new memberships were received, accompanied by messages of support and goodwill from labour leaders around the world—further igniting optimism for the future of the confederation.
With growing participation from both countries and confederations, the ILC continues to expand its influence and reaffirm its commitment to promoting labour rights in the digital age.
